Telangana seeks Rs.1,000 crore from Centre as drought relief

The Telangana government on Tuesday declared 231 mandals in the state as drought affected and sought Rs.1,000 crore as immediate relief from the Centre.

Chief Minister K. Chandrasekhar Rao also urged the central government to send a team to assess the drought situation.

The decision to declare 231 mandals -- one third of the total mandals -- as drought affected was taken at a meeting chaired by the chief minister to review the situation.

Rainfall was normal only in Khammam and Adilabad districts. Mahabubnagar, Medak, Nizamabad and Ranga Reddy districts were totally drought affected. Partial drought prevailed in the districts of Karimnagar, Nalgonda and Warangal.

The chief minister told reporters that a delegation led by Agriculture Minister Pocharam Srinivas Reddy will visit Delhi to submit to the Centre the list of drought affected mandals.

KCR said his government had embarked on redesigning of irrigation projects to find a permanent solution to the frequent droughts.

He said the government had also set a target of irrigating one crore acres of land by 2021.
